The Benefits of Cooking Salmon

Salmon is not only delicious but also packed with nutrients.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, it promotes heart health and has anti-inflammatory properties. Regularly consuming salmon can improve brain function and may help reduce the risk of chronic diseases. It's a smart choice for anyone looking to maintain a balanced diet.

In addition to its health benefits, salmon is incredibly versatile. It pairs well with a variety of flavors from zesty citrus to aromatic herbs. This adaptability makes it a staple in many cuisines around the world. Whether you grill, bake, or pan-sear it, salmon consistently delivers phenomenal taste and texture.

Ingredients

For the Salmon

  • 4 salmon fillets
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il

For the Garlic Lemon Butter Sauce

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ped

Feel free to customize the ingredients as per your taste!

Instructions

Prepare the Salmon

Season the salmon fillets with salt and pepper.

Cook the Salmon

In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the salmon fillets and cook for 4-5 minutes on each side until golden and cooked through.

Make the Sauce

In the same skillet, reduce heat and melt butter. Add minced garlic and cook until fragrant. Stir in lemon juice and parsley.

Combine

Drizzle the garlic lemon butter sauce over the cooked salmon and serve immediately.

Storage and Reheating Tips

If you have leftovers, storing your salmon properly is key to maintaining its flavors. Allow the salmon to cool before sealing it in an airtight container. Store it in the refrigerator, where it will last for up to three days. For longer storage, you can freeze the cooked salmon, but it’s best to consume it within three months for optimal freshness.

When reheating, gentle methods work best. Use a microwave at a low power setting or reheat it in a skillet over low heat, drizzling a little water over it to keep it moist. This will prevent the salmon from drying out and ensure you enjoy its rich flavors once again.

Variations to Try

While the garlic lemon butter sauce is a winner, don’t hesitate to experiment with different flavor profiles. You might consider adding capers for a briny touch or a splash of white wine to the sauce for added depth. Each variation can bring a fresh twist to this classic dish, making it feel new and exciting.

For a spicy kick, try adding red pepper flakes to the sauce. Alternatively, substitute the lemon juice with lime juice for a different zesty note. These subtle changes can transform the recipe into something uniquely yours and keep your weekly menu exciting!
